Helen was born in Winston Salem, NC to Janette and Charles Apostle. Most of Helen's life was spent between Greensboro, NC, New Market, VA, Harrington Park, NJ and West Chester, PA. Helen married Edward M. Brown, Jr. of Endless Caverns, New Market, VA at the age of 16. Edward was in the Army during WWII in 1942. Helen and Edward had two daughters, Janette and Esther. Edward passed away in February of 1990. Helen was a homemaker and at one time, Manager of the Joshua Tree in Wayne, PA. She started there as a baker and in a short time was running the whole place. She had many talents: accomplished pianist, painter, master gardener; fantastic and creative cook; created crossword puzzles and entered them in national level competitions. She was a talented painter, quilter, knitter and a fine seamstress, who at one time created and sewed all of her fine suits, coats and dresses. She loved cats (please see favorites Buddy and Jamie on home page), cooking, listening to opera and baseball (especially the World Series). Helen's friends would describe her as a very talented and creative person who was very involved in the lives of her daughters and grandchildren, Justin and Angela.
